(3-Bromophenyl)triphenylsilane Properties

Melting point 135.0 to 139.0 °C
Boiling point 469.9±37.0 °C(Predicted)
Density 1.30±0.1 g/cm3(Predicted)
storage temp. Sealed in dry,Room Temperature
form powder to crystal
color White to Light yellow

(3-Bromophenyl)triphenylsilane Chemical Properties,Uses,Production

Uses

(3-Bromophenyl)triphenylsilane is used as a material for organic electroluminescent elements, display devices and lighting devices.

Synthesis

1,3-Dibromobenzene 20 g (84.77 mmol) was dissolved in THF 500 mL and then cooled to a temperature of -78. n-BuLi 2.5M 33.9 mL(84.77 mmol) was slowly added thereinto and then stirred at a temperature of -78 for 1 hour. Chlorotriphenylsilane ((C6H5)3SiCl) 29.9 g was dissolved in THF 100 mL, and this solution was added to the above reaction mixture. The resultant mixture was slowly warmed to room temperature and stirred for 12 hours. Then, extraction with EA, wash with distilled water and aqueous NaCl solution, drying over MgSO4, distillation under reduced pressure, and recrystallization with MC-MeOH in the ratio of 1:10, were sequentially performed, thereby obtaining (3-Bromophenyl)triphenylsilane 18 g(95 percent).
